These caves are worth a visit although they did not seem to be on a bus route, so you may need a hire car to reach them. Tours are approximately every half an hour and there is a seated waiting area with a lovely view, snack bar, toilets and small gift shop. Tickets were 10 euros per adult (in 2012). The tour lasts about 40 minutes starting with a ten-minute walk to the entrance. The guide tries his best to describe the cave in numerous languages, although it is difficult to hear, so just enjoy the views. Generally, an enjoyable visit and the owners have made good use of lighting to improve the attraction.
